Description:

The Department of Linguistics and Translation invites applications for the
full-time, tenure-track position of Assistant Professor in Translation
(English/French), with specialization in translation revision and
post-editing. 

Responsibilities: 
The appointed candidate will be expected to teach undergraduate and graduate
courses, supervise graduate students, be active in research, publishing, and
the diffusion of knowledge, and contribute to the activities of the
University. 

The successful candidate will contribute to the Department’s programs in
general and specialized translation (English/French) by training language
specialists in general translation, translation revision and postediting;
teaching requirements will also include French/English writing and
self-editing courses.

The appointed candidate will be expected to conduct and supervise research on
theoretical, methodological, or formal questions in Translation studies,
dealing more specifically with issues such as translation revision and
post-editing, writing and self-editing for translation, computer-aided
translation, or the human-machine interface in the context of translation. 

Requirements:  
 - Ph. D in Translation Studies or a related discipline (Candidates completing
dissertation will also be considered);
 - Strong research record in the field; 
 - Demonstrated ability to provide high-quality university teaching; 
 - Demonstrated research interests in translation revision, post-editing, or
translation technologies;
 - Mastery of the French language, both spoken and written;
 - Membership in the Ordre des Traducteurs, Terminologues et Interprètes
Agréés du Québec (OTTIAQ) or other recognized professional association will be
considered an asset.
